Victoria man opts for medically assisted death after cancer treatment delayed (Times Colonist)

Dan Quayle marked his 52nd birthday on Oct. 7 in Victoria General Hospital waiting to find out when chemotherapy would start for an aggressive form of esophageal cancer. He would die waiting. After 10 weeks in hospital, Quayle, a gregarious grandfather who put on his best silly act for his two grandkids, was in so much pain, unable to eat or walk, he opted for a medically assisted death on Nov. 24 — despite assurances from doctors that chemotherapy had the potential to prolong his life by a year ...
